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42772 42 525 8577 713871501
404960 8088532495 66121324801
404960 8088532495 66121324801
927037900 56 08748084
All about undefined
Interested in learning more?
404960 8088532495 66121324801
927037900 56 08748084
See more
562808068 839 459663
68573524633 11370590762 8556378105 5290665
See more
4759795296 1295791559 647141
296 74 00330 806
See more